    1. Durability and Longevity FRP ceiling grids are highly resistant to corrosion, moisture, and chemicals. This makes them suitable for environments prone to high humidity or exposure to harmful substances, such as commercial kitchens, laboratories, and industrial facilities. Unlike traditional materials like metal or wood, FRP does not warp, rot, or degrade over time, ensuring a long-lasting installation.

    3. Sound Absorption The sound-dampening properties of gypsum contribute to a quieter indoor environment. Vinyl coated gypsum ceiling tiles can help in mitigating noise pollution, making them ideal for spaces such as offices, restaurants, schools, and healthcare facilities where acoustics play an essential role in the overall experience.


    Industrial applications also benefit from calcium silicate grid ceilings, particularly in manufacturing facilities and warehouses where durability and hygiene are paramount. Their resistance to moisture ensures that the ceilings remain intact and functional in challenging conditions.
